What It Is

Fix the Field,
Not Your Budget.

The leach field is the underground bed that filters wastewater back into the soil. When it starts to fail, the reflex from a lot of companies is to quote a full replacement — the biggest, most profitable job there is.

We start the other way around. We locate and diagnose the field, repair the failing sections where we can, and only recommend replacement when the field genuinely requires it — and we will show you why.

Our Escalation Path

The Repair-First
Ladder.

We climb these rungs in order — and we stop the moment your field is working again. Full replacement is the last resort, not the opening pitch.

01

Locate & Diagnose

We find the field and pinpoint exactly where and why it is failing — saturation, clogging, or a collapsed line.

Start Here
02

Clear & Rejuvenate

Often the field is choked, not dead. Clearing lines and restoring drainage can bring it back to service.

Try First
03

Repair the Failed Section

If one area has given out, we repair or replace just that section — leaving the working parts of the field alone.

Try First
04

Replace — Only If Needed

If the field is genuinely at end of life, we rebuild it right, with the evidence to show you why it was necessary.

Last Resort
